Pros of Gastric Balloon

Non-surgical

The gastric balloon is often a non-surgical and minimally invasive treatment that generally takes less than an hour to complete. The truth is, most people are discharged inside a few several hours or every day in the procedure, supplied there isn't any difficulties.

Wondering how this method works? Though the affected person is mildly sedated, an endoscope with a deflated silicone balloon is inserted through the patient’s mouth. Guided by the endoscope’s smaller digital camera, the surgeon proceeds to place these balloons inside the tummy just before it’s filled with saline.

The balloon aims to occupy a massive Section of the stomach, leaving a small Room to retail outlet foodstuff and generating sufferers truly feel satiated a lot quicker. This will lower meals consumption and subsequent weight-loss.

Safe and effective

The weight reduction balloon underwent clinical trials just before it was approved by the FDA and is particularly staying ongoing to become reviewed for its basic safety and success. Based upon the Preliminary trials of 326 obese clients, balloon in stomach for weight loss the team that acquired gastric balloons shed 6.8% of their physique weight versus The three.3% weight reduction of the team that didn’t.

Additionally, the analyze revealed that clients who been given the gastric balloon continued to lose excess weight six months once the gadget was removed.

Cheaper than other bariatric surgery

Bariatric medical procedures inside the US can variety among $7,423 to $33,541 and can vary on several aspects, including the complexity from the technique, the Visit this website location of your clinic, and the surgeon’s knowledge. Keep in mind that these are frequently foundation costs only and even now don’t contain linked fees.

Weight loss balloons commonly selection close to $6,000 to $9,000, making it The most cost effective bariatric course of action while in the place. Side consequences write-up-gastric balloon

There are conditions in which some patients discontinue the 6-month method on account of Extraordinary Unwanted side effects, which include nausea and vomiting, abdominal ache, acid reflux, and digestion troubles.

Discomfort will likely be common several hours and times after the course of action Considering that the abdomen remains finding accustomed to the balloon. Even so, if you are getting it complicated to consume or drink resulting from ongoing Uncomfortable side effects, it’s essential to speak to your health practitioner promptly to find out essentially the most ideal program of motion based upon your conditions.
